Some spaces or other invisible characters still remain in your worksheet? Hello! The shorter the message, the larger the prize, Proving that the ratio of the hypotenuse of an isosceles right triangle to the leg is irrational. removing strange characters from php string Asked 13 years, 11 months ago Modified 2 years, 9 months ago Viewed 67k times 28 this is what i have right now Drawing an RSS feed into the php, the raw xml from the rss feed reads: Paul's Confidence The php that i have so far is this. I also found this useful snippit that may help others with same problem; Thanks everyone for your time and consideration. In this case, you can take 1 character from the first position while replacing it with an empty string (). So, lets get started: Choose a cell range that you need to remove the character. Will spinning a bullet really fast without changing its linear velocity make it do more damage? In the example shown, the formula in C4 is: = SUBSTITUTE (B4, CHAR (202),"") Which removes a series of 4 invisible characters at the start of each cell in column B. If you have a specific set of characters that you want to remove, use the "Blank template". This is the most basic approach and inefficient on a performance point of view. Practice Excel functions and formulas with our 100% free practice worksheets! Thanks for contributing an answer to Code Review Stack Exchange! "<br>"; echo trim ($str,"Hed!"); ?> Try it Yourself Definition and Usage The trim () function removes whitespace and other predefined characters from both sides of a string. Just one great product and a great company! Templates Blank - Empty list All non-alphanumeric - Deletes any character/symbol that is not a number or letter (in upper or lower case) preg_match () - Mark Baker Dec 23, 2013 at 10:48 This looks like JSON. Eventually, the # symbol is no more displayed because it is deleted from the cell range selected in it. This doesn't answer the specific question. Below, I'll illustrate the concept with a couple of practical examples. preg_replace php function is used to remove special characters from a string except space in php. Don't type anything in the Replace field and leave it blank. You have presented an alternative solution, but haven't reviewed the code. *?X/ Replace X with whatever characters you want or don't want (e.g. You will notice the difference to RIGHT so that it can extract that many characters from the end of the string. Thanks a lot :). I want to learn VLOOKup and Getdata function in Excel. Before each recursive call, the IF function checks the remaining chars. I'd be interested in hearing others' opinions about this whether I'm setting myself up for problems by setting webserver to UTF-8 while storing submitted data in Latin1 in our mysql database. Python programmers are often faced with the problem of removing unwanted characters from a string. Learn more about Stack Overflow the company, and our products. I just it posted it wrong because I include what it should turn out. LOOP . we need to use: $title = 'Stefen Suraj'; $newtitle = preg_replace('/[^(\x20-\x7F)]*/','', $title); echo $newtitle; It does not work If you want to remove unwanted characters from a cell, use the SUBSTITUTE Function to replace the unwanted character with blank text (""). Allowed characters is a parameter, so you can reuse the method in various places. Try disabling automatic calculations in Excel as described in this article. That is not what I meant. If the chars string is not empty (chars<>""), the function calls itself. Removing characters in Excel is not always so easy, sometimes your desired characters are placed somewhere you cannot find and removed instantly. What is the coil for in these cheap tweeters? For example "1234-67-901-3456" should become "1234679013456," and "abd./def-\ghijkl" should become "abcdefghijk."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Curious to try our Remove tool? The str.replace () function makes it possible to replace a specific character using a specific value. to become: If you see the outcome is not what you needed, simply press CTRL + Z, and all the functions will be reversed instantly, and you will get the original data back in front of you.
Remove Special Characters from String Python - GeeksforGeeks I am trying to get this into the format "1713 St Patrick St Apt 145". If no "bad" character is found the variable #I is returned as 0. There is so much docs out there talking about specifying character encoding to utf-8but this is the only thing that really worked for me! Replace all characters except letters, numbers, spaces and underscores. Are glass cockpit or steam gauge GA aircraft safer? How to change what program Apple ProDOS 'starts' when booting. That means those characters have different values in the Unicode character set. The str_replace () function is an inbuilt function in PHP which is used to replace all the occurrences of the search string or array of search strings by replacement string or array of replacement strings in the given string or array respectively. 1.The order of the strings in the $find array is significant. if your string contains these type of strange chars I use exceljet every week at my workplace. Not the answer you're looking for? 589). The solution only works in Excel for Microsoft 365. While FILTER_SANITIZE_NUMBER_FLOAT gives the expected output, using filter_var is a messy solution - it's a blackbox whose function is far from clear. The special ascii characters " etc. Press CTRL + H and the Find and Replace toolbox will appear. strager 87392 Similar Question and Answer Remove identical succesive characters from string PHP What is the coil for in these cheap tweeters?
How to: Strip Invalid Characters from a String | Microsoft Learn To delete a specific character from a cell, replace it with an empty string by using the SUBSTITUTE function in its simplest form: SUBSTITUTE ( cell, char, "") For example, to eradicate a question mark from A2, the formula in B2 is: =SUBSTITUTE (A2, "?", "") by Svetlana Cheusheva, updated on April 12, 2023. The address of the cell containing the special characters is, On the add-in's pane, pick the source range, select, Sort and filter links by different criteria, Find, extract, replace, and remove strings by means of regexes, Customizable and adaptive mail merge templates, Personalized merge fields depending on the recipient or context, "Send immediately" and "send later" scheduling. These still count as a character when using string functions like left, right, mid or split and therefore cause issues with most common string data preparation steps. Once you successfully remove the characters from a string, your data could turn into a new dataset. you might want to try. How best can this be done? Remove all commas, as described in the article above, and then do a reverse substitution of that character for a comma. List of 100+ most-used Excel Functions. Connect and share knowledge within a single location that is structured and easy to search. Learn the essentials of VBA with this one-of-a-kind interactive tutorial. This looks like JSON. 589). If for example you wanted to remove the characters A, B and C, you would define it as: [ "A", "B", "C" ] Create a compose action to define the string to have characters removed. My Excel life changed a lot for the better! Learn Excel with high quality video training. Below you can see some examples.
Trimming and Removing Characters from Strings in .NET Learn 30 of Excels most-used functions with 60+ interactive exercises and many more examples. Remove Unwanted Characters. One can use str.replace () inside a loop to check for a bad_char and then replace it with the empty string hence removing it. What's the significance of a C function declaration in parentheses apparently forever calling itself? Adding labels on map layout legend boxes using QGIS. Modified date: Is this subpanel installation up to code? EXECUTE. IF #I > 0 X=CONCAT(SUBSTR(X,1,#I-1),SUBSTR(X,#I+1)). For this, press Ctrl + F3 to open the Name Manager, and then define a New Name in this way: For the detailed instructions, please see How to name a custom LAMBDA function. What is the motivation for infinity category theory? is this correct or what is the correct way, thank you all. This will show you exactly which characters are written into the string. below the mysql connection code. [PHP] remove unwanted characters from a string Hello Guest, Why not Register today? rev2023.7.14.43533. How would life, that thrives on the magic of trees, survive in an area with limited trees? 70+ professional tools for Microsoft Excel. How to Remove Characters from Multiple Cells with Find and Replace Option. Mail Merge is a time-saving approach to organizing your personal email events. So by passing the allowedCharacters as an optional parameter with an additional check with IsNullOrEmpty(). htmlentities php function is ued to removr html special chars from a string in php. Please l need help, substitute formula didn't work. Add this to the HTML head (or modify if already there): This will encode the funny chars like "" into UTF-8 so that the str_replace() function will interpret them properly. If you have a fixed string, you can do it with some string functions: This works by finding the : in that string and substract it till the end.
Formula - Remove Unwanted Characters - Automate Excel This syntax strips out the unwanted characters from the X variable. How to remove characters from a string in PHP, How to Calculate Age based on Birthday (DOB) in PHP, 9 Popular Free Online Discussion Forum Sites, The Best Web Design Software and Free Resources 2020, 10 Programming Languages You Should Learn in 2019, List of No Logs Virtual Private Network (VPN) Services, List of Popular Virtual Private Network (VPN) Services, Electronics Mart IPO, Grey Market Premium, Stock and Company Details, WhatsApp New Features: Groups now supports 512 members, 23 Smart Ways To Drive More Traffic To Your Blog, 7 Ways to get More Traffic to your YouTube Videos. Simply by applying the above methods, anyone can handle the task easily. /** * Convert and clean uploaded filenames in WordPress. Using a regexp as described by jorge is more robust, however may not cope with some input scenarios. You can alternatively put the hyphen at the beginning or end of the character class. Read carefully the first paragraph of the article above.
PHP trim() Function - W3Schools suppose $text contains some of these then just do as shown bellow: Thanks for contributing an answer to Stack Overflow! All Rights Reserved. Is iMac FusionDrive->dual SSD migration any different from HDD->SDD upgrade from Time Machine perspective? 2.This string "" should contain a tilde and look like three characters. Browse other questions tagged,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site. Your email address is private and not shared. You can remove a single character using the SUBSTITUTE function, however, if your cell . Example: PIPE,,,3/4" X 6 meters,,SCH. 1 Do you get the correct result? Related functions: Samples Should be Hi there, I am trying to cleanse some address data. An exercise in Data Oriented Design & Multi Threading in C++. Syntax: str_replace ( $searchVal, $replaceVal, $subjectVal, $count ) Great add-in that I use daily, Need Excel, you will want Ablebits Ultimate Suite, Time saver and excellent support makes Ultimate Suite a no-brainer, I've been using the Ablebits product for several years, Ultimate Suite turns Excel into what it should have always been, Ablebits occupies a unique place for Excel users. Our next step is to remove any special characters from the string. (you may have white-space trouble in the start of the string, though) - h2ooooooo Dec 23, 2013 at 10:46 Of course, there are easier ways: e.g. But in my case, any characters can appear in my input string, and I only want to keep the characters that I want (without messing up the order of course). We have tutorials, demos, products reviews & offers for web developers & designers. Press the ENTER key and you will get the replaced character. You have to convert data according to your choice so that it could be useful. If you do not want to delete the first comma, replace it with another character using the SUBSTITUTE function. =SUBSTITUTE(A1,"#",""), Is there a formula to remove the commas and any special characters. I would like to know more various examples and details about the recursive usage of LAMBDA function. There are also several templates readily available for you to use. what is the correct way to do that. PHP has the str_replace () and preg_replace () functions that you can use to remove special characters from a string. To extract all the text before a specific character, you can use the Excel TEXTBEFORE function. Supports Excel for Microsoft 365, Excel 2019 - 2010. Technically, it strips off the first 32 characters in the 7-bit ASCII set (codes 0 through 31). This will remove all non-ascii characters / special characters from a string. For more general cleaning, see the TRIM function and the CLEAN function. Seems to be a short fix rather than the larger issue, but it works. The SUBSTITUTE function can find and replace text in a cell, wherever it occurs. ", ""), "", ""), "?
Removing Characters in Excel - How to Remove Unwanted Characters In this example, you will find a column named Delivery Details from which you have to remove the delivery status and get the Address by using the Replace function. No need to add separators like commas, or escape characters. Whenever you have to search for literals.
Remove special characters from a PHP string | sebhastian The Overflow #186: Do large language models know what theyre talking about? Pay attention to the following paragraph of the article above: Delete multiple characters from string.
If you're using the same set of allowed characters in a lot of places, stick them in some sort of settings store. What is the workaround for this?
how to remove unwanted characters from string in PHP But you can use also this which is more easy to understand: People are suggesting regex's and explodes, why? Strip any unknown characters from string php. With the Ultimate Suite installed, this is what you need to do: In a moment, you will get a perfect result: If something goes wrong, don't worry - a backup copy of your worksheet will be created automatically as the Back up this worksheet box is selected by default.
Remove Special Character in PHP | Delft Stack There is no problem in your approach. ): With the SUBSTITUTE Function, as shown in the examples above, its only possible to remove one text string (or character) at a time.
[PHP] remove unwanted characters from a string - Neowin The LOOP sets up a repetition which will continue until the END LOOP condition is met. So, what would you do with these unwanted entries? We as TalkersCode may receive compensation from some of the companies whose products we review. mysqli_set_charset($con,"utf8"); Whenever I see filtering, I tend to think LINQ. expected output after processing : From what I've seen in other posts, if I actually know the unwanted characters, then I can do string.replace(). Stack Exchange network consists of 182 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. rev2023.7.14.43533.
An empty string can be substituted for that specific character if we wish to remove it. Thats slow and not needed. If a character is found, SPSS takes the text up to that character, then the remaining text past that character. The next example demonstrates a more compact and elegant solution. AutoMacro for Excel is an Excel add-in that makes it simple to automate Excel. $newtitle = $item->title; $newtitle = utf8_decode ($newtitle); Asking for help, clarification, or responding to other answers. For instance, the character code of a non-breaking space ( ) is 160 and you can purge it using this formula: To erase a specific non-printing character, you need to find its code value first.
Remove unwanted characters - Excel formula | Exceljet $string = preg_replace ("/ [^ \w]+/", "", $string); Remove specific word from string in php Delete particular word from string using php str_replace function. Are Tucker's Kobolds scarier under 5e rules than in previous editions?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. We use cookies to ensure that we give you the best experience on our website. 5 Stars from me. There are also several templates readily available for you to use. Our Statistics forum is Live! 3.This is a useful reference https://www.i18nqa.com/debug/utf8-debug.html. LOOP . I was able to remove "INC-" and "Railroad Street" from the cell, which left me with "2022-08-01-1107" and I need to remove the "--1107" from the cell. For practical use, be sure to include all the characters you want to delete in the following line: This custom function is named RemoveSpecialChars and it requires just one argument - the original string: To strip off special characters from our dataset, the formula is: Microsoft Excel has a special function to delete nonprinting characters - the CLEAN function. Just type the characters you want to be removed in the text box and click remove. score:0 Check with: / [^\d\s\w] {3,}/ mck89 18575 score:0 /X.*?X. In our case, the unwanted character ("") comes last in cell A2, so we are using a combination of the CODE and RIGHT functions to retrieve its unique code value, which is 191: Once you get the character's code, serve the corresponding CHAR function to the generic formula above. 16 June 2018, [{"Product":{"code":"SSLVMB","label":"IBM SPSS Statistics"},"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Component":"Not Applicable","Platform":[{"code":"PF016","label":"Linux"},{"code":"PF014","label":"iOS"},{"code":"PF033","label":"Windows"}],"Version":"Not Applicable","Edition":"","Line of Business":{"code":"LOB10","label":"Data and AI"}}], Removing unwanted characters from strings. Code Review Stack Exchange is a question and answer site for peer programmer code reviews. BOLT,,,STUD,,,M8X3m,,, 4. Need more help? Choose a cell range from which you need to remove a character. This goes into the CODE function, which reports the characters code value, which is 202 in the example shown. In this article we will show you the solution of python remove special characters from string, the removal of a character from a string may sometimes be necessary while programming in Python. In one of the previous articles, we looked at how to remove specific characters from strings in Excel by nesting several SUBSTITUTE functions one into another. Starting the Prompt Design Site: A New Home in our Stack Exchange Neighborhood, Making as many unique strings as possible by removing two characters, Most common letter in string, trying to use idiomatic Ruby, Identify the Length of the Longest Substring Without Repeating Characters, Sort string's characters into alphabetic order, Longest word in dictionary that is a subsequence of a given string, Increment each digit in a number to form a new number, Method encodes all less than (<) characters in a HTML string, but not the HTML tags, Remove all unwanted characters from a string buffer, in-place. Once this new string has been created, we can assign it back to the original variable. Remove Special Characters in Excel & Google Sheets, Return Address of Highest Value in Range Excel & G Sheets . By having a const string which contains all of your wanted chars, you could do either a simple call to Contains() or check if IndexOf() will return a value > -1. using string concatenation in a loop is mostly a bad idea. Is it legal to not accept cash as a brick and mortar establishment in France? Is iMac FusionDrive->dual SSD migration any different from HDD->SDD upgrade from Time Machine perspective? Co-author uses ChatGPT for academic writing - is it ethical? How are you getting the array in the first place because there may be a far simpler way than extracting that JSON string then manipulating it as a string.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Please explain your reasoning (how your solution works and how it improves upon the original) so that the author can learn from your thought process. Future society where tipping is mandatory, Do symbolic integration of function including \[ScriptCapitalL]. Type your response just once, save it as a template and reuse whenever you want. ELBOW,4" Hello! It covers your case completely. I thought, @Liren There are digits besides 0-9. I highly recommend the Ablebits Ultimate Suite, Would recommend it to anyone who works with Excel, I have found the Ablebits app and website to be extremely useful, Ablebits Ultimate Suite is invaluable if you work with spreadsheets, Extremely useful add-in with extensive functionality, If that's not good service, I don't know what is. I want to only -37.8087928 part. The best answers are voted up and rise to the top, Not the answer you're looking for? Starting the Prompt Design Site: A New Home in our Stack Exchange Neighborhood, Temporary policy: Generative AI (e.g., ChatGPT) is banned. You need to put the '' (right side double smart quote) at the end of the array or it's going to match anything starting with . Using the Find and Replace tool lets you easily find and replace the character that you dont want anymore. Lets find out how you can do it: When you need to remove the first character from a string, try using REPLACE option, or else you can use both the RIGHT and LEN functions together. Are glass cockpit or steam gauge GA aircraft safer? Find all links in your document, get them verified, correct invalid ones and remove unnecessary entries with a click to keep your document neat and up to date. And RIGHT LEN functions, both give you the same outcome. (Or, How can I remove or delete special characters from a PHP string?). Then, a regex pattern is created to match every special character in the string. however, if my data is 2632.91737 using same formula it deletes the ".". Instead of building formulas or performing intricate multi-step operations, start the add-in and have any text manipulation accomplished with a mouse click. The original string does not get changed when using these methods since strings are immutable. The INDEX function locates the first occurrence of any of the "bad" characters defined in between the quotes. In cases where you need to clean up and remove unwanted characters from user-generated input, removing characters from strings can be useful. 1 Sign in to vote Hi, You can achieve the same through Regex too. If your Tardis just landed in 1963, and you just want the 7 bit printable ASCII chars, you can rip out everything from 0-31 and 127-255 with this: $string = preg_replace ('/ [\x00-\x1F\x7F-\xFF]/', '', $string); It matches anything in range 0-31, 127-255 and removes it. I'm really sorry, looks like this is not possible with the standard Excel options. Super simple solution is to have the characters decoded when the page is loaded, Simply copy/paste the following at the beginning of the script, Reference: http://php.net/manual/en/function.mb-internal-encoding.php
how to remove unwanted characters from string in PHP Step By Step Guide On Python Remove Special Characters From String :-. TalkersCode is one of the best and biggest website for web developers in India.
Secu Holidays 2023 Near North Carolina,
What Do Coral Reefs Need To Survive,
Bungee Fitness Stuart, Fl,
How To Get Someone Fired Anonymously,
Articles H